创意编程课程介绍
睿陶
阅读:526
2024-04-28 09:12:14
评论:0
探索创意编程:激发学习者的想象力与创造力
创意编程是一种融合了计算机编程和艺术创造的教育方法,旨在激发学习者的想象力与创造力。通过创意编程课程,学生可以学习编程技能,同时将其应用于创造出独特的艺术作品、游戏、动画等。本文将探讨创意编程课程的核心理念、教学方法以及实施建议。
理念
创意编程课程的核心理念在于将编程技能与创意表达相结合,让学生通过编程来实现他们的想法和创意。这种课程强调学生的主动参与和探索,鼓励他们从不同的角度思考问题,并将计算机编程作为实现创意的工具。
教学方法
1.
项目驱动学习
:创意编程课程通常采用项目驱动的学习方法。学生通过完成具体的项目来学习编程技能,例如制作简单的游戏、动画或艺术作品。这种方法可以激发学生的学习兴趣,同时培养他们的解决问题的能力。2.
开放式任务
:课程设计应该注重开放式任务,让学生有足够的自由度来发挥想象力和创造力。教师可以提供一些基本的指导和资源,但鼓励学生根据自己的兴趣和想法进行探索和实践。3.
跨学科整合
:创意编程课程可以跨越多个学科领域,例如艺术、设计、数学和科学。通过将编程与其他学科整合在一起,可以帮助学生更全面地理解知识,并将其应用于实际创作中。4.
合作与分享
:鼓励学生之间的合作与分享是创意编程课程的重要组成部分。学生可以在团队中合作完成项目,共同解决问题,并相互分享彼此的创意和成果。这种合作与分享可以促进学生之间的交流与学习。实施建议
1.
灵活的课程设置
:设计灵活的课程设置,允许学生根据自己的学习进度和兴趣选择课程内容。提供多样化的项目选择,满足不同学生的需求和学习目标。2.
丰富的资源支持
:提供丰富的资源支持,包括编程工具、教学视频、在线社区等。这些资源可以帮助学生更好地理解课程内容,解决问题,并与他人交流分享经验。3.
定期反馈与评估
:定期提供反馈与评估是课程实施的关键步骤。通过评估学生的作品和表现,及时发现问题并提供指导,帮助他们不断改进和成长。4.
鼓励创新与实践
:创意编程课程的目的在于激发学生的创新精神和实践能力。教师应该鼓励学生不断尝试新的想法和技术,勇于面对挑战,并从失败中吸取经验教训。结语
创意编程课程为学生提供了一个探索和实践的平台,帮助他们培养创造力、解决问题的能力和团队合作精神。通过创意编程,学生不仅可以学习编程技能,还可以发展自己独特的艺术风格和创作思维,为未来的发展打下坚实的基础。